Victoria overhauls contact tracing system – The Australian Financial Review
Victoria’s contact racing system is being completely rebuilt, decentralised and supported by a purpose built cloud system to speed up tracing.

Mr Andrews said the new technology platform would use a specialist cloud platform developed by Salesforce to “consolidate and align many different platforms into one platform”.
“It just means that there is less pen and paper, there is less manual data entry,” he said.
He said it would facilitate the decentralisation of contact tracing and enable everyone to have access to the same system.
New regional centres set up last month will now be emulated in metropolitan Melbourne across five regions…
